(n.) Any one of several small singing birds somewhat resembling the true sparrows in form or habits, as the European hedge sparrow. It is a small bird that has a typical length of 16 cm (6.3 in) and a mass of 24â39.5 g (0.85â1.39 oz). Though found in widely varied habitats and climates, it typically avoids extensive woodlands, grasslands, and deserts away from human development. [77], Especially in warmer areas, the house sparrow may build its nests in the open, on the branches of trees, especially evergreens and hawthorns, or in the nests of large birds such as storks or magpies. Attempts to control house sparrows include the trapping, poisoning, or shooting of adults; the destruction of their nests and eggs; or less directly, blocking nest holes and scaring off sparrows with noise, glue, or porcupine wire. [121] True bugs, ants, sawflies, and beetles are also important, but house sparrows take advantage of whatever foods are abundant to feed their young. [89][95] On a larger scale, it is most abundant in wheat-growing areas such as the Midwestern United States. [79][86] In South America, it was first introduced near Buenos Aires around 1870, and quickly became common in most of the southern part of the continent. One of about 25 species in the genus Passer, the house sparrow is native to most of Europe, the Mediterranean Basin, and a large part of Asia. The female spends the night incubating during this period, while the male roosts near the nest. [139][144] House sparrows do not hold territories, but they defend their nests aggressively against intruders of the same sex. [116][118] The house sparrow also eats some plant matter besides seeds, including buds, berries, and fruits such as grapes and cherries.
